> > Do you have a libjson-plugin.so in syslog-ng --module-registry output?
> > Also, can you check your configure output if libjson-c was detected?
>
> OK, I was able to get this working; my previous test hadn't fully ensured
> syslog-ng was built with --enable-json. Ensuring 'json-c' is available
> during the configure stage and re-building corrected this (no 'format-json'
> error at runtime and no need to remove the 'cim' directory).
